Qualifying Applicants


There are two methods for qualifying an applicant to determine the likelihood that they may generate tax credits for you. You may send applicants to a website to answer the brief questionnaire to determine eligibility, or you may have them complete a paper questionnaire along with their application. The answers to the paper application may then be entered into the qualifying website.

With either approach, you will have immediate feedback as to whether the applicant may generate credits for you. This data is stored by the website. Once you hire an applicant, you may then forward the data through the website to the Tax Credit Processing Center for processing.
